Post by SaveTheNight on Mar 24th, 2005, 11:14pm
i'm with Andrew there and I have also yet to see an LSD on the Cossie .. it's possible although unlikely taking into account the action of the traction control  etc .. the only one similar that I know of is the 2wd Sierra cossie diff which does run traction with lsd ..but quite complex viscous coupling BUT only on one side of the planetry gears .. so not sure .. beemers do have it though but again more complex ..anyway gaz ..you are right and the 2.9 12v and the Cossie are the same diff .. seven and a half inch < nice > ..and 3.64 ratio rather than err 4.3 ? on the others .. gawd my memory  arghhhhh  .. regards ....STN
